BACKGROUND: Pulmonary sarcomatoid carcinoma is a rare tumor that is resistant to cytotoxic agents. This observational study aimed to evaluate the detection rate of driver gene alteration and the efficacy of targeted therapy for pulmonary sarcomatoid carcinoma. METHODS: We established a database of patients with pulmonary sarcomatoid carcinoma and their clinical information, including EGFR mutation, ALK fusion gene, ROS1 fusion gene, BRAF mutation, and MET exon 14 skipping mutation. The present study retrieved and analyzed the data of patients with pulmonary sarcomatoid carcinoma in whom driver gene alterations were evaluated, and the survival duration after the initiation of treatment with targeted therapy was examined. RESULTS: A total of 44 patients were included in the present study. The EGFR mutation, ALK fusion gene, and MET exon 14 skipping mutation were detected in 2/43 patients (4.7%), 2/34 patients (5.9%), and 2/16 patients (12.5%), respectively. The ROS1 fusion gene (0/18 patients) and BRAF mutation (0/15 patients) were not detected. Female patients (P = 0.063, Fisher's exact test) and patients without smoking history (P = 0.025, Fisher's exact test) were the dominant groups in which any driver mutation was detected. Five patients with driver gene alterations were treated with targeted therapy. Progression-free survival (PFS) was 1.3 months and 1.6 months in 2 of the patients treated with gefitinib. Two patients with the ALK fusion gene showed 2.1 and 14.0 months of PFS from the initiation of treatment with crizotinib, and a patient with the MET exon 14 skipping mutation showed 9.7 months of PFS from the initiation of treatment with tepotinib. CONCLUSION: The EGFR mutation, ALK fusion gene, and MET exon 14 skipping mutation were detected in patients with pulmonary sarcomatoid carcinoma in clinical practice, and some patients achieved long survival times after receiving targeted therapy. Further investigation is necessary to evaluate the efficacy of targeted therapy for pulmonary sarcomatoid carcinoma.

In epidermal growth factor receptor (EGFR)-mutant non-small cell lung cancer (NSCLC) with negative or low programmed death ligand-1 (PD-L1) expression, the acquisition rate of the T790M mutation is higher after treatment with first-/second-generation EGFR-tyrosine kinase inhibitors (TKIs) and the progression-free survival (PFS) is longer in patients treated with osimertinib. The present study compared the clinical course after the initiation of each EGFR-TKI monotherapy in patients with EGFR-mutant NSCLC with negative or low PD-L1 expression. Data of patients with EGFR-mutant NSCLC with negative or low PD-L1 expression who were treated with EGFR-TKI monotherapy were retrieved and retrospectively analyzed. Between June 2013 and November 2023, 26 and 29 patients were treated with first-/second-generation EGFR-TKIs and osimertinib, respectively. The PFS time was longer in patients treated with osimertinib (median, 22.5 months) than in those treated with first-/second-generation EGFR-TKIs (median, 12.9 months). However, the EGFR-TKI treatment duration, defined as the PFS for osimertinib, or the sum of the PFS for first-/second-generation EGFR-TKIs and sequential osimertinib therapy after the acquisition of the T790M mutation, was similar between patients treated with first-/second-generation EGFR-TKIs (median, 23.0 months) and osimertinib (median, 22.5 months). The Cox proportional hazard model suggested that there was no significant difference in the EGFR-TKI treatment duration between patients treated with first-/second-generation EGFR-TKIs and patients treated with osimertinib (hazard ratio, 1.31, 95% CI, 0.55-3.13). In conclusion, first-/second-generation EGFR-TKIs and osimertinib were associated with a similar EGFR-TKI treatment duration in patients with EGFR-mutant NSCLC with negative or low PD-L1 expression. The findings suggested that both treatments are promising for this population.

Introduction: We aimed to clarify long-term renal prognosis, complications of malignancy, glucocorticoid (GC) toxicity, and mortality in immunoglobulin G4 (IgG4)-related kidney disease (IgG4-RKD). Methods: Reviewing the medical records of 95 patients with IgG4-RKD, we investigated clinical and pathologic features at baseline, the course of renal function, complications of malignancy, GC toxicity, and mortality during follow-up (median 71 months). The standardized incidence ratio (SIR) of malignancy and standardized mortality ratio were calculated using national statistics. Factors related to outcomes were assessed by Cox regression analyses. Results: At diagnosis, the median estimated glomerular infiltration rate (eGFR) was 46 ml/min per 1.73 m2. GC achieved initial improvement. Additional renal function recovery within 3-months of initial treatment occurred in patients with highly elevated serum IgG and IgG4 levels and hypocomplementemia. During follow-up, 68%, 17%, and 3% of the patients had chronic kidney disease (CKD), >30% eGFR decline, and end-stage renal disease (ESRD), respectively. Age-adjusted and sex-adjusted Cox regression analyses indicated that eGFR (hazard ratio [HR], 0.71) and extensive fibrosis (HR, 2.58) at treatment initiation had a significant impact on the time to CKD. Ten patients died, and the standardized mortality ratio was 0.94. The SIR of malignancy was 1.52. The incidence rate (IR) of severe infection was 1.80/100 person-years. Cox regression analyses showed that the best eGFR within 3 months after treatment initiation were associated with lower mortality (HR 0.67) and fewer severe infections (HR 0.63). Conclusion: This study suggests that more renal function recovery through early treatment initiation may improve patient survival, renal outcomes, and some GC-related complications in IgG4-RKD.

BACKGROUND/AIM: Combined therapy with immune checkpoint inhibitors plus platinum doublet chemotherapy has a survival advantage over platinum doublet chemotherapy in patients with non-small cell lung cancer. However, a variety of factors make it difficult to administer treatment with platinum doublet chemotherapy in many patients in clinical practice and there are few reports on the efficacy and safety of first-line treatments with immune checkpoint inhibitors for patients who are ineligible for platinum doublet chemotherapy. This observational study aimed to evaluate the efficacy and safety of first-line immune checkpoint inhibitor therapy for this population. PATIENTS AND METHODS: We retrospectively assessed the survival and adverse events from the initiation of first-line immune checkpoint inhibitor therapy, including pembrolizumab or nivolumab plus ipilimumab in patients with non-small cell lung cancer who were ineligible for platinum doublet chemotherapy. RESULTS: Data from 48 patients were analyzed. Seventeen patients showed a performance status (PS) of ≥2 while 16 and 15 patients were considered ineligible for platinum doublet chemotherapy because of age and comorbidities, respectively. The median (95% confidential interval, CI) progression-free survival (PFS) and overall survival (OS) of the 48 patients were 7.1 (1.7-13.7) and 31.7 (8.8-not estimated) months, respectively. The two-year PFS and OS rates (95% CI) were 30.8% (18.2%-47.2%) and 50.7% (33.7%-67.7%), respectively. In patients with a PS of ≥2, the median (95% CI) PFS and OS were 1.6 (1.2-not estimated) and 5.5 (2.3-not estimated) months, respectively. The two-year PFS and OS rates (95% CI) were 34.3% (15.8%-59.2%) and 45.3% (22.2%-70.7%), respectively. CONCLUSION: Patients with non-small cell lung cancer and a PS of 0-1 who were ineligible for platinum doublet chemotherapy had favorable outcome after the initiation of ICI therapy, and even in patients with a PS of ≥2, they achieved high two-year PFS and OS rates.

In 2011, the Comprehensive Diagnostic Criteria for IgG4-related disease was published in Japan. Organ-specific diagnostic criteria based on organ-specific findings were proposed and published by each of the related societies, and the diagnostic criteria for IgG4-related respiratory disease was published in 2015. Based on the revisions to the comprehensive diagnostic criteria in 2020 and the publication of the Classification Criteria, new diagnostic criteria for IgG4-related respiratory disease are presented. Emphasis has been placed on evaluating specific pathological findings and excluding other respiratory diseases. It is mentioned in the commentary that in cases with imaging findings suggestive of interstitial pneumonia with chronic fibrosis or poor response to steroid therapy, other possible diseases should be considered.

Immunoglobulin G4-related disease (IgG4-RD) is a newly recognized disease, and therefore its clinical features are not yet fully understood. Here, we describe a surgical case of metachronous bilateral IgG4-related pleuritis and postoperative chylothorax. This case could provide key insights into the pathology of IgG4-RD from a surgical perspective. We present a 70-year-old woman who had a right pleural mass. Video-assisted thoracoscopic pleural mass resection was performed, and the patient was diagnosed with right-sided IgG4-related pleuritis. Two years later, she was also diagnosed with left-sided IgG4-related pleuritis. We suspected the presence of IgG4-positive plasma cell infiltration. Additionally, she experienced a complicated postoperative chylothorax on the left side. It is important to consider the altered course of lymphatic vessels when extensively removing the pleura near the right thoracic duct. The occurrence of metachronous bilateral IgG4-associated pleuritis has not been previously reported, making this case particularly significant for understanding the pathology of IgG4-RD from a surgical standpoint.

Immune checkpoint inhibitors have significantly improved the prognosis in patients with non-small cell lung cancer, compared with cytotoxic agents. However, the prediction of treatment response is often difficult, even after assessing the tumor programmed death-ligand 1 expression. We conducted this observational study to analyze the association between the differentiation of peripheral CD4 + T cells and the efficacy of immune checkpoint inhibitor therapy. We enrolled patients who were diagnosed with non-small cell lung cancer and received immune checkpoint inhibitor therapy between 2020 and 2022. Blood samples were collected at the start of immune checkpoint inhibitor therapy, and the expressions of PD-1, CCR7, and CD45RA in peripheral CD4 + T cells were analyzed by flow cytometry. The association between the findings of flow cytometry and survival after the initiation of the immune checkpoint inhibitor therapy was evaluated. Forty patients with non-small cell lung cancer were enrolled. The Cox proportional hazards model showed that an increased proportion of CD45RA-CD4 + T cells was associated with a reduced risk of progression after adjustment for performance status, tumor programmed death-ligand 1 expression level, mutation status of the epidermal growth factor receptor gene, and combined therapy with cytotoxic agents. The present study showed that the proportion of peripheral CD45RA- CD4 + T cells was associated with progression-free survival after the initiation of immune checkpoint inhibitor therapy, independent of several clinical factors.

BACKGROUND/AIM: Among patients with non-small cell lung cancer (NSCLC) treated with immune checkpoint inhibitors (ICI), survival is reported to be longer in those experiencing immune-related adverse events (irAEs). We evaluated the progression-free survival (PFS) in the absence of further treatment after ICI therapy was discontinued because of the emergence of irAEs in patients with NSCLC. PATIENTS AND METHODS: Data from patients with NSCLC in whom ICI therapy was discontinued because of the development of irAEs were retrospectively analyzed. The primary endpoint was the PFS from the last day of administration of ICIs, in the absence of any further treatment. RESULTS: A total of 162 patients with NSCLC received treatment with ICIs between January 2016 and December 2021. Among them, ICI therapy was discontinued in 33 patients because of the appearance of irAEs. The median (95% confidence interval) PFS in the absence of any treatment after the last administration of ICIs was 7.2 (4.2-12.3) months. According to the Common Terminology Criteria for Adverse Events, the Cox proportional hazards model was used to identify the severity of irAEs, which were determined to be significantly associated with the PFS in the absence of any further treatment after the last administration of ICI therapy. CONCLUSION: Although the present study showed that the PFS in patients with NSCLC was relatively long in the absence of any further treatment after the last administration of ICIs, the PFS was associated with the severity of the irAEs, and some patients showed early disease progression or death.

Immune checkpoint inhibitor (ICI) therapy has been less effective in patients with non-small cell lung cancer (NSCLC) harboring epidermal growth factor receptor (EGFR) mutations than in patients with EGFR wild-type NSCLC. This retrospective study was conducted to investigate the associations of clinical parameters with the efficacy of ICI therapy in patients with EGFR-mutant NSCLC. Clinical information was retrieved from the medical charts, and immunohistochemical analysis was performed in some cases to determine the tumor-infiltrating CD68-positive cell count. Data from 46 patients were included in the analysis. The median (95% confidence interval) progression-free survival and overall survival from the initiation of ICI therapy was 1.4 months (1.0-1.7 months) and 6.4 months (3.9-19.0 months), respectively. Analysis using a Cox proportional hazards model revealed that tumor programmed death-ligand 1 expression was associated with the overall survival of patients with EGFR-mutant NSCLC after ICI treatment. The tumor-infiltrating CD68-positive cell count was evaluated in 11 patients. Comparison using the log-rank test revealed that the progression-free survival time after ICI treatment was longer in the patients with lower tumor-infiltrating CD68-positive cell counts than those with higher tumor-infiltrating CD68-positive cell counts. The present analysis demonstrated that PD-L1 expression and the tumor-infiltrating CD68-positive cell count may be associated with the efficacy of ICI therapy in patients with NSCLC harboring EGFR mutations.

OBJECTIVE: Studies have suggested the potential efficacy of immune checkpoint inhibitors (ICIs) for pulmonary sarcomatoid carcinoma. This multicenter observational study was conducted to evaluate the efficacy of systemic ICI therapy and chemoradiation followed by durvalumab therapy for pulmonary sarcomatoid carcinoma. METHODS: We analyzed the data of patients with pulmonary sarcomatoid carcinoma who received systemic ICI therapy or chemoradiation followed by durvalumab therapy between 2016 and 2022. RESULTS: In this study, data of a total of 22 patients who received systemic ICI therapy and four patients who received chemoradiation followed by durvalumab therapy were analyzed. In the patients who received systemic ICI therapy, the median progression-free survival after initiation of therapy was 9.6 months, and the overall survival did not reach the median. The 1-year progression-free survival rate and overall survival rate were estimated to be 45.5% and 50.1%, respectively. Although the log-rank test revealed no significant association between the tumor expression level of programmed death ligand-1 (tumor proportion score evaluated using 22C3 antibody: ≥50% vs. <50%) and the survival duration, the majority of patients showing long-term survival showed a tumor proportion score of ≥50%. Of four patients treated with chemoradiation followed by durvalumab therapy, two patients showed an overall survival of ≥30 months, whereas the remaining two patients died within 12 months. CONCLUSION: The progression-free survival of patients who received systemic ICI therapy was 9.6 months, suggesting that ICI therapy might be effective in patients with pulmonary sarcomatoid carcinoma.

Recent advances in the management and understanding of immunoglobulin (Ig)G4-related kidney disease (RKD) have emphasized the importance of urgent treatment in IgG4-related tubulointerstitial nephritis. On the other hand, to avoid long-term glucocorticoid toxicity, strategies for early withdrawal of steroids or combination of immunosuppressants, such as rituximab, and the minimum dose of steroids have been pursued. However, disease recurrence after reducing or stopping steroid therapy hampers early withdrawal of glucocorticoid maintenance therapy. In addition, knowledge has accumulated in diagnostic approaches including differential diagnosis of anti-neutrophil cytoplasmic antibodies-associated vasculitis, idiopathic multicentric Castleman's disease, and Rosai-Dorfman disease with kidney lesion, which leads to earlier and precise diagnosis of IgG4-RKD. This review summarizes recent progress in the differential diagnosis of IgG4-RKD and related treatment strategies and recent topics of hypocomplementaemia, membranous glomerulonephritis, and IgG4-related pyelitis and periureteral lesion.

BACKGROUND/AIM: The association between tumor PD-L1 expression and the rate of acquisition of the T790M mutation during treatment with first-/second-generation epidermal growth factor receptor-tyrosine kinase inhibitors (EGFR-TKIs) is a matter of study. This retrospective study was conducted to evaluate the association of tumor PD-L1 expression with the time on treatment under EGFR-TKIs in patients with EGFR-mutant non-small cell lung cancer (NSCLC), treated with first-/second-generation EGFR-TKIs. PATIENTS AND METHODS: We conducted a retrospective review of the medical charts of patients with EGFR-mutant NSCLC treated with first- /second-generation EGFR-TKIs. Time on treatment with EGFR-TKIs was defined as the sum of progression-free survival period (PFS) from the start of treatment with first- /second-generation EGFR-TKIs and the PFS from the start of osimertinib treatment after acquisition of the T790M mutation. Tumor PD-L1 expression was evaluated using the 22C3 antibody. RESULTS: Data of a total of 49 patients were analyzed, including 20 patients with negative tumor PD-L1 expression (tumor proportion score <1%) and 29 patients with positive tumor PD-L1 expression (tumor proportion score ≥1%). In the negative tumor PD-L1 expression group, the T790M mutation was detected in 12 (75%) of the 16 patients. In the positive tumor PD-L1 expression group, the T790M mutation was detected 6 (31.6%) out of the 19 patients in whom it was tested. The median (95% confidence interval) time on treatment with EGFR-TKIs was 21.7 (12.9-24.8) months and 12.3 (5.6-22.2) months in the negative and positive tumor PD-L1 expression groups, respectively. Analysis using a Cox proportional hazards model identified performance status and presence/absence of tumor PD-L1 expression as significantly associated with the time on treatment with EGFR-TKIs. CONCLUSION: EGFR-mutant NSCLC patients with negative tumor PD-L1 expression showed a higher rate of acquisition of the T790M mutation and implementation rate of osimertinib therapy, leading to a longer time on treatment with EGFR-TKI.

Hopong, a small town in the Salween (Thanlwin) River Basin, Myanmar, is located 35 km northeast of Inle Lake, a famous ancient lake with numerous endemic fish species. We surveyed the fish fauna of a spring pond in Hopong in 2016, 2019 and 2020 and identified 25 species. Of these, seven, including Inlecyprisauropurpureus and Sawbwaresplendens, had been considered endemic to Inle Lake and at least three species were genetically unique. Eight were suspected or definite introduced species, including Oreochromisniloticus and Gambusiaaffinis. We were unable to identify a nemacheilid species of the genus Petruichthys, which would need a taxonomic examination. The Hopong area is being developed rapidly and, hence, it is crucial to conserve its native fish species and the freshwater ecosystems.

BACKGROUND: Small cell lung cancer (SCLC) is a very aggressive cancer and recurrence is inevitable. Treatment of recurrent disease is important for improving the prognosis of patients with SCLC. METHODS: We conducted a retrospective observational study to investigate the efficacy and safety of irinotecan monotherapy as third- or further-line treatment in patients with SCLC. RESULTS: Data of 15 patients who had received irinotecan monotherapy as third- or further-line treatment between 2004 and 2019 were analyzed. The median progression-free survival duration (95% confidence interval) from the initiation of treatment with irinotecan was 2.7 (1.4-3.8) months, and the median overall survival duration (95% confidence interval) from the initiation of irinotecan treatment was 10.0 (3.9-12.9) months. Partial response, stable disease or non-complete response/non-progressive disease, and progressive disease were observed in 1, 6, and 8 patients, respectively. Adverse events ⩾ grade 3 in severity were observed in 2/2 (100%) patients who were homozygous for UGT1A1 mutation, 2/3 (66.7%) patients who were heterozygous for UGT1A1 mutation, 4/6 (66.7%) patients who had wild-type UGT1A1, and 2/4 (50.0%) patients in whom the UGT1A1 mutation status was unknown. CONCLUSION: Our results suggest that irinotecan monotherapy can be a useful alternative treatment option in the third-line setting for patients with SCLC.

AIM: We report, herein, three cases of pleomorphic carcinoma of the lung treated with immune checkpoint inhibitors. Case 1: A 73-year-old man was diagnosed as having pleomorphic carcinoma of the lung and treated with pembrolizumab alone. However, he showed no response and died 4 months after the initiation of the treatment. Case 2: A 66-year-old man was diagnosed as having pleomorphic carcinoma of the lung. He was started on a combination regimen of pembrolizumab plus carboplatin plus nab-paclitaxel, and a remarkable response was observed. Case 3: A 49-year-old man was diagnosed as having pleomorphic carcinoma of the lung. He was started on pembrolizumab monotherapy as second-line treatment. Eleven months after the treatment initiation, computed tomography revealed the decrease of tumor diameter. CONCLUSION: Immune checkpoint inhibitor therapy is expected to improve the prognosis of patients with pleomorphic carcinoma of the lung.

RATIONALE: Immunoglobulin (Ig) G4-related disease (IgG4-RD) is a novel clinical disease entity characterized by an elevated serum IgG4 concentration and tumefaction or tissue infiltration by IgG4-positive plasma cells. Pathological changes are most frequently seen in the pancreas, lacrimal glands, and salivary glands, but pathological changes in the lung also exist. Linker for activation of T cell (LAT)Y136F knock-in mice show Th2-dominant immunoreactions with elevated serum IgG1 levels, corresponding to human IgG4. We have reported that LATY136F knock-in mice display several characteristic features of IgG4-RD and concluded that they constitute an appropriate model of human IgG4-RD in salivary glands, pancreas, and kidney lesions. OBJECTIVES: The aim of this study is to evaluate whether lung lesions in LATY136F knock-in mice can be a model of IgG4-related lung disease. METHODS: Lung tissue samples from LATY136F knock-in mice (LAT) and wild-type mice (WT) were immunostained for IgG1 and obtained for pathological evaluation, and cell fractions and cytokine levels in broncho-alveolar lavage fluid (BALF) were analyzed. RESULTS: In the LAT group, IgG1-positive inflammatory cells increased starting at 4 weeks of age and peaked at 10 weeks of age. The total cell count and percentage of lymphocytes increased significantly in BALF in the LAT group compared to the WT group. In BALF, Th2-dominant cytokines and transforming growth factor-ß were also increased. In the LAT group, marked inflammation around broncho-vascular bundles peaked at 10 weeks of age. After 10 weeks, fibrosis around broncho-vascular bundles and bronchiectasis were observed in LATY136F knock-in mice but not WT mice. CONCLUSIONS: LATY136F knock-in mice constitute an appropriate model of lung lesions in IgG4-RD.

Background/Aim: We conducted a retrospective analysis of the survival durations of 25 patients diagnosed as having non-squamous cell non-small cell lung cancer with negative or low tumor programmed death-ligand 1 (PD-L1) expression treated with immune checkpoint inhibitor (ICI) monotherapy. Patients and Methods: The progression-free (PFS) and overall (OS) survival were calculated from the initiation of ICI monotherapy. The association between the patient characteristics and the PFS was analyzed using Cox proportional hazards model. Results: The median PFS was 2.6 months, and the 12-month PFS rate was 9.3%. The median OS was 5.5 months, and the 12-month OS rate was 39.8%. A Cox proportional hazards model identified the neutrophil/lymphocyte ratio and presence of liver metastasis as being significantly associated with PFS. Conclusion: Our findings suggest that a subset of patients with non-squamous cell non-small cell lung cancer who show negative or low tumor PD-L1 expression could benefit from ICI monotherapy.

OBJECTIVES: Immunoglobulin G4-related disease (IgG4-RD) is a systemic, multiorgan disease of unknown etiology. We aimed to classify IgG4-RD by a combination pattern of affected organs and identify the clinical features, including the comorbidities of each subgroup. METHODS: Patients diagnosed with IgG4-RD between April 1996 and June 2018 were enrolled from three institutes. Hierarchical cluster analysis was performed using six frequently affected organs (lacrimal gland and/or orbit, salivary gland, lung, pancreas, kidney, and retroperitone and/or aorta). Clinical features, such as comorbidities and outcomes, were compared between clusters. RESULTS: In total, 108 patients enrolled in this cohort could be stratified into five distinct subgroups: group 1, lung dominant group; group 2, retroperitoneal fibrosis and/or aortitis dominant group; group 3, salivary glands limited group; group 4, Mikulicz's disease dominant group; and group 5, autoimmune pancreatitis with systemic involvement group. There were significant between-group differences in sex (male dominant in group 1, 2, and 5), history of asthma and allergies on the respiratory tract (most frequent in group 5), and malignancy (most frequent in group 5). CONCLUSION: IgG4-RD can be classified into subgroups according to the pattern of affected organs. Group 5 may have frequent complications with allergies and malignancies.
